  • Demystifying Ethics Approvals
    2024/12/02

    Ethics approvals can appear daunting, but they really are not. Ethics is always a 'negotiation on a continuum' and your application for ethics approval is part of that negotiation. Yes, you are likely to get feedback and need to make amendments, so ensure you plan your documentation and timelines accordingly. This episode briefly explores the steps in the process, so that you can start getting yourself ready! Don't leave it to the last minute, because you need this before your data collection!

  • Transitioning from Coursework to Independent Research
    2024/12/02

    Undergraduate and many masters level programmes are structured. The student is told what to read, and how to progress. The PhD is very self driven though; you are in the drivers seat, and that responsibility can be quite daunting at first. In this episode we look at some key challenges and strategies to ensure a smooth transition, and to ensure that you are mentally prepared for your PhD journey, and ready to take ownership of the project!
